Vaiśaṃpāyana uvāca | rājñas tu vacanaṃ śrutvā dharmārthasahitaṃ hitam | kṛṣṇā dāśārham āsīnam abravīc chokakarśitā ||
Vaiśaṃpāyana said: Having heard the king’s words—beneficial and grounded in both dharma and practical purpose—Kṛṣṇā (Draupadī), worn down by grief, addressed Dāśārha (Śrī Kṛṣṇa) as he sat there.
